JOB SUMMARY : The Radiology Technologist performs competent and skilled diagnostic radiological studies, consistently producing the highest quality exams possible for physician review.
Essential Job Responsibilities with demonstrated competency:
· Possesses abilities to work collaboratively with all members of the health care team to provide safe care to the patient throughout his surgical experience.
· Demonstrates knowledge in the ability to plan, prepare imaging equipment for proper views.
· Understands and anticipates expected procedure course of events and prepares for and responds with expediency.
Technical Competency: Abilities, Skill, Knowledge required for success in the work environment
· Possesses necessary knowledge of anatomy and physiology of the human body as well as the ability to recognize abnormal conditions.
· Performs radiology exams using good placement judgment in scanning, photographing and documenting anatomy & pathology.
· Demonstrates competency in handling radiographic equipment, correct exposure and location.
· Assists physician with invasive procedures requiring radiographic imaging.
· Possesses vocabulary of imaging techniques, association by recognition and understands functional applications.
· Retains advanced aptitude for technical knowledge and the functional use of equipment, and sophisticated supplies.
· Maintains the sterile field and acts appropriately with corrective action when sterility has been breached.
· Astute awareness to rapidly changing conditions in the work environment that requires rapid intervention and appropriate action. Manages competing demands based on thorough investigation or under the direction of the physician.
· Able to read and interpret technical written information or instructions and apply according to operate equipment safely.
· Possesses the knowledge and abilities to complete the process of imaging storage and reproduction in hard copy.
· Methodically applies rational thought to practices which insure an environment of safety for the patient when radiation is present.
· Consistently applies hand hygiene practices and other aseptic techniques before, during and after administering direct patient care.
· Protects patient privacy during direct patient care and the understanding of HIPAA ruling of PHI.

Qualifications:
· Graduate of an accreditated school of Radiology Technology.
· Registry with ARRT (active)
· One year of Radiology Technologist experience preferred.
· Must be CPR certified within six (6) months of hire date and maintain certification
· Successful completion of Radiation Safety standardized test.
Language Ability:
Read, analyze, and interpret and reiterate information from equipment operators manuals, technical transcripts, procedure manuals. Recognize and use medical terminology. Effectively communicate information and respond to questions from physicians, peers, managers.
Math Ability:
Add, subtract, multiply, and divide in all units of measure, using whole numbers, common fractions, and decimals. Calculate rate, ratio, and percentage.
Computer Skills:
To perform this job successfully, an individual should have knowledge of Word Processing software and windows platforms.
Work Environment:
The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
While performing the duty of this job, the employee is repeatedly exposed to potentially infectious material, and biological bodily fluids. This job is Category I of the OSHA definitions. Occasionally exposed to fumes or airborne particles; toxic or caustic chemicals and pharmaceutical waste and risk of radiation. The noise level in the work environment is usually moderate.
Physical Demands:
The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
The employee must regularly lift and /or move up to 25 pounds.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, peripheral vision, depth perception and ability to adjust focus. While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to stand stationary for long periods; walk; have use of hands & fingers, touch or feels; reach with hands and arms; speak, listen, and smell. The employee is frequently required to sit and stoop, kneel, push, pull, crouch, or crawl.
